Our Story

The DER Society originated from a simple debate club founded at the International School of Carthage in Tunisia. Back then, it was a great success among students. Membership kept increasing and, most importantly, the project had a real impact on individuals. Teenagers who feared speaking in public quickly started to enjoy it. They overcame their fear and became comfortable speaking up and sharing their thoughts. The DER brought an enthusiasm for debate that had not been seen before at this establishment.

This success led to greater ambitions. As we realized the potential of this project, we decided not to limit it to a single high school, but to open it up. Henceforth, the expansion of the DER began. It became a nationwide Tunisian organization that opened clubs in different institutions. Members from different places started to connect, creating a community of passionate speakers. Multiple events were organized, notably debate competitions, in which young people demonstrated their skills in eloquence and rhetoric. This step was reinforced through partnerships with Oxford and Cambridge, which granted us the status of an official round partner of their Debate Unions.

In 2025, we revised our ambitions upward and decided to pursue a global scope. Therefore, the DER Society, as a global organization, was founded in Switzerland. We now aim to promote debate, eloquence, and rhetoric internationally, welcoming all those who wish to contribute to our mission.

Legal Status

The Debate, Eloquence & Rhetoric Society is a non-profit Association governed by Articles 60 et seq. of the Swiss Civil Code.

Headquarters: 1022 Chavannes-près-Renens, Vaud, Switzerland.
